16 changes: 16 additions & 0 deletions lib/std/posix.zig
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-798,6 +798,10 @@ pub const ReadError = error{
/// In WASI, this error occurs when the file descriptor does
/// not hold the required rights to read from it.
AccessDenied,

/// This error occurs in Linux if the process to be read from
/// no longer exists.
ProcessNotFound,
} || UnexpectedError;

/// Returns the number of bytes that were read, which can be less than
Expand Down Expand Up @@ -854,6 +858,7 @@ pub fn read(fd: fd_t, buf: []u8) ReadError!usize {
.INTR => continue,
.INVAL => unreachable,
.FAULT => unreachable,
.NOENT => return error.ProcessNotFound,
.AGAIN => return error.WouldBlock,
.CANCELED => return error.Canceled,
.BADF => return error.NotOpenForReading, // Can be a race condition.
Expand Down Expand Up @@ -917,6 +922,7 @@ pub fn readv(fd: fd_t, iov: []const iovec) ReadError!usize {
.INTR => continue,
.INVAL => unreachable,
.FAULT => unreachable,
.NOENT => return error.ProcessNotFound,
.AGAIN => return error.WouldBlock,
.BADF => return error.NotOpenForReading, // can be a race condition
.IO => return error.InputOutput,
